Route 66, the iconic American highway known as the “Main Street of America,” celebrated its 100th anniversary in 2026. Despite decades of development and modernization, it remains a popular destination for travelers and history enthusiasts, fueled by a sense of nostalgia and cultural pride.

The highway was officially established in 1926, stretching approximately 2,448 miles from Chicago to Santa Monica. Over the past century, it has become a symbol of American mobility, adventure, and the changing landscape of the nation.

Recent celebrations included events across multiple states, featuring vintage car parades, historical exhibitions, and community festivals. Tourism along the route has seen a resurgence, with travelers seeking the classic Americana experience that Route 66 epitomizes, according to organizers and local businesses.

While parts of the highway have been replaced or bypassed by modern interstates, many segments remain preserved or restored, maintaining the nostalgic charm that attracts visitors. Preservation efforts are ongoing, supported by local governments and historical societies aiming to keep the route’s legacy alive.

Historical Milestones and Preservation of Route 66

Established in 1926, Route 66 was one of the original highways in the U.S. Highway System. It facilitated westward migration during the Dust Bowl era and became a cultural icon through the mid-20th century, featured in songs, movies, and literature. The highway was officially decommissioned as a federal route in 1985, but its legacy persisted.

In recent decades, preservation efforts have focused on maintaining historic segments, with organizations like the Route 66 Association working to restore signage, landmarks, and roadside attractions. The route’s nostalgic appeal remains strong, attracting travelers seeking a glimpse into America’s past.

Unresolved Challenges in Preserving Route 66’s Legacy

It is not yet clear how many original segments of Route 66 will be preserved long-term, or how modern infrastructure developments will impact its historic character. Funding and political support for preservation efforts vary across states, posing ongoing challenges.

Key Questions

Why is Route 66 considered an American icon?

Route 66 symbolizes American mobility, freedom, and the spirit of adventure, having played a key role in migration, commerce, and pop culture over the past century.

Are all parts of Route 66 still drivable?

Many segments are preserved or restored and remain drivable, but some parts have been replaced or are inaccessible. Travelers should check local conditions before planning a trip.

How are communities celebrating the centennial?

Communities along the route are hosting festivals, vintage car shows, historical exhibitions, and promotional events to mark the milestone and attract visitors.

What efforts are underway to preserve Route 66?

Various organizations and local governments are working to restore landmarks, maintain signage, and promote tourism to keep the route’s history alive.

Will Route 66 receive any special federal recognition?

There are ongoing discussions about designating parts of Route 66 as a national historic corridor, which could bolster preservation and tourism efforts.
